    Which is the better choice Innova E or Innova J both manual diesel.

    Innva E costs 110Thou more than the cost of Innova J but it has mag wheels, power windows and power mirrors.

    Which do you think is the better buy or better bang for the buck so to speak?

    I shall appreciate your comments fellow tsikoteers.

    Php 119K to be exact.

    Aside from features you have mentioned, you are actually paying for the ABS and Driver side Air Bag, you are paying for additional safety features not found on J variant. Other aesthetic features like colored key door handles and seat material has minimal cost.

    Paying PhP119K for the features you mentioned plus Air Bag and ABS is already bang for bucks.

    These are things that the J variant can never have, even with the help from the after market:

    1.) ABS
    2.) Driver side airbag
    3.) Four spoke steering wheels: (bec. of the airbag)
    4.) Color: flaxen - choose this color makes your Innova look more upscale since it is available for E and G variant only.
    5.) Factory power windows - those after market ones seem substandard.

    Overall, if the budget allows, E variant is worth purchasing.
